Miracle on 34th Street(1947)
96 mins
type: 
genre(s):
COMEDY
DRAMA
FAMILY
Kris Kringle, seemingly the embodiment of Santa Claus, is asked to portray the jolly old fellow at Macy's following his performance in the Thanksgiving Day parade. His portrayal is so complete that many begin to question if he truly is Santa Claus, while others question his sanity.

yearawardcategoryname
1947 Academy Award Best Actor in a Supporting Role Edmund Gwenn
1947 Academy Award Best Screenplay George Seaton
1947 Golden Globe Award Best Screenplay George Seaton
1947 Golden Globe Award Best Supporting Actor Edmund Gwenn
